Appalachian trail

The Appalachian trail traverses the property providing stunning hiking opportunities including a scenic trek to the Thundering Brook Falls. Additionally, Killington has 45 miles (72 km) of hiking and mountain biking trails, Killington Mountain Bike Club (KMBC) has trails on the hill on the opposite side of the pond only a few minutes away. an 18-hole golf course as well as some magnificent zip lines and a mountain coaster.

KILLINGTON OFFERs SKI TRAILS

For Everyone-beginners and experts alike. Ski Trails include the Outer Limits, and a selection of five snowboard and alpine parks as well as the Accelerated Learning Area for beginners. For the more ambitious, Killington has one of the largest half-pipes in the east (on Bear Mountain) as well as a broad range of boarder cross terrain trails and several major trails with ramps and jumps.

Fishing

Fishing season has started! Kent Pond has largemouth bass, pumpkinseed sunfish, and trout.

ON TWO WHEELS

The Killington Valley area is home to some of New England’s finest mountain biking
terrain and road cycling tours. Bring your own bike, or rent equipment and sign up for
one of the many quality touring options in the area. There is something for everyone with
beginner to advanced trails, and new ones being added constantly.
